Transaction 43afc874f1c2b8ea40203f13f45cde0c8a51fa72226d34e9f71b0c690c3034a6

1 Input
2 Outputs
  • 43afc874f1c2b8ea40203f13f45cde0c8a51fa72226d34e9f71b0c690c3034a6:0
  • value  22025693
    address  3LTcqbU8JPrrQrWJ1hvqaUKqwkaXmxScpw
  • 43afc874f1c2b8ea40203f13f45cde0c8a51fa72226d34e9f71b0c690c3034a6:1
  • value  26624022
    address  3MLYrgRdFNinySLdXZ7UgHawJ8MFirZhZq